North Korea condemns South Korea for distributing anti-DPRK leaflets

  According to a report by the Korean Central News Agency on the 4th, the first deputy minister of the Workers’ Party of Korea, Kim Yu-jung, issued a statement entitled “Don’t set fire to the body” that day, strongly condemning the “North Korean defectors” for distributing anti-DPRK leaflets from Korea to the DPRK.

  The talk said that the "North Korean defectors" distributed anti-DPRK flyers to the DPRK on May 31, slandered North Korea's supreme leader and used the "nuclear issue" to speak, and maliciously slander the DPRK. The ROK will not be unaware of the Panmunjom Declaration and the terms of the military agreement promised by the North and the South regarding the prohibition of the distribution of leaflets and other hostile acts along the military demarcation line. However, the South Korean side indulged in this and should bear the responsibility.

  If the ROK does not take measures against the above misconduct, the DPRK may dismantle the Kaesong Industrial Park or close the DPRK-ROK joint liaison office or ban the DPRK-ROK military agreement after prohibiting Mount Kumgang. (Headquarters reporter Dong Haitao)
